Rohan had a cuboidal box having dimensions of 36 cm ×
25 cm × 20 cm. He packed into it as many cubes as possible, each of which has edges 4 cm long. How much space will be still left in the box?Solution
Volume of the cuboidal = (36 × 25 × 20) cm³ Maximum volume of the cubes which can fit into the box. (36 x 24 × 20) cm³ (24 cm because that is the max dimension of 4 cm that can cover for space of 25 cm) of the cube. Now, the space left (36 x 25 x 20) - (36 × 24 × 20) 18000-17280 = 720 cm3 720 cm³ space will be still left in the box.
